Review: Everlane Slim Silk and Silk Round Collar Shirts.

OH MY GOD YOU GUYS HELP ME. I recently ordered two different Everlane silk blouses and I have no idea what to do. Keep both? Return both? Keep one? I was initially unimpressed when I tried them on right out of the packaging (so wrinkly!) but now that they're all pressed and pretty I'm having a hard time deciding.

First impression: Everlane silk is really nice quality, especially for the price. Weighty with a nice sheen. The fit and colors are where my hesitation lies. I ordered the Slim Silk Shirt in black and the Silk Round Collar in light grey. First the Slim Silk Shirt:


I got the Slim Silk in my usual size 6 and it fits nicely through the shoulders and the sleeves hit exactly where they should, but it does catch slightly on my hips. It's also a bit shorter, which I'm not sure is quite so flattering on me. The black silk is actually a washed greyish-black which I like a lot, but if you were expecting black-black this isn't it. It doesn't quite skim over my hips like I'd like, but I'm not sure going up a size would fix this. I do like that it fits nicely through my narrow shoulders which almost never happens. 



I bought the Round Collar in a medium because I liked the light grey color and they were sold out of the small. It's an older style (from before they moved to number sizing) so probably won't be restocked. It's definitely an oversized fit and the sleeves are a bit long, but they look pretty cute rolled up, so that doesn't bother me. And I adore the cute round collar. But, does it look too big? 


The color is a very light warm grey and I like it, but I'm not sure it's super flattering on me. (Definitely different than anything I own.) I do love the length and how it skims over my hips:
